Partager via


CHStringArray ::Add, méthode (chstrarr.h)

[La classe CHStringArray fait partie de l’infrastructure du fournisseur WMI, qui est maintenant considérée dans l’état final, et aucun développement, amélioration ou mise à jour supplémentaire ne sera disponible pour les problèmes non liés à la sécurité affectant ces bibliothèques. Les API MI doivent être utilisées dans tout nouveau développement.]

La méthode Add ajoute un nouvel élément à la fin d’un tableau, augmentant le tableau d’un.

Syntaxe

int  throw(CHeap_Exception) Add(
  LPCWSTR newElement
);

Paramètres

newElement

Élément à ajouter au tableau.

Valeur retournée

Si la méthode Add réussit, elle retourne l’index de l’élément ajouté.

Remarques

Si SetSize a été utilisé avec une valeur nGrowBy supérieure à 1, une mémoire supplémentaire peut être allouée. Toutefois, la limite supérieure augmente d’un seul.

Exemples

L’exemple de code suivant montre l’utilisation de Add.

    CHStringArray array;
    CHString s( L"String 2");
    
    array.Add( L"String 1" ); // Element 0
    array.Add( s );           // Element 1

Configuration requise

Condition requise Valeur
Client minimal pris en charge Windows Vista
Serveur minimal pris en charge Windows Server 2008
Plateforme cible Windows
En-tête chstrarr.h (inclure FwCommon.h)
Bibliothèque FrameDyn.lib
DLL FrameDynOS.dll ; FrameDyn.dll

Voir aussi

CHStringArray

CHStringArray ::Append

CHStringArray ::Copy